Getting Cash For Your Junk Car Can Be Quick, Easy, And Convenient

One of the primary reasons that people often choose to put off getting rid of an old junk car is because they believe this process will be a hassle. With all the daily responsibilities that many people juggle, it is easy to convince yourself to keep putting off doing something with that old clunker that is just taking up space on your property. If you have found yourself stuck in this same cycle of procrastination, you should know that getting cash for your junk car can actually be very quick, easy, and convenient. In fact, this process can typically be completed in a single day with just three very simple steps.

Step 1: Contact A Local Salvage Yard

One of the great things about selling a junk car is that finding an interested buyer is often much easier than when selling a vehicle to a private buyer. This is because most salvage yards will be willing to purchase just about any vehicle regardless of its condition. In order to find out how much your junk car is worth, simply pick up the phone and contact a local salvage yard. This process usually takes only a few minutes and can be completed with some very basic info about your car. Just be sure you are completely honest when answering their questions in order to ensure you get an accurate offer for your vehicle. 

Step 2: Get Your Vehicle Towed

If you have been putting off selling your junk car because you don't want to pay for towing services, you will be incredibly happy to learn about this step in the process. This is because when selling your vehicle to a local salvage yard, the buyer will take care of having a tow truck sent to your home to pick up the vehicle. This means that you will not need to worry about any out-of-pocket expenses when choosing to sell your junk car. To make this perk even better, most salvage yards will be able to arrange for your vehicle to be towed the very same day.

Step 3: Receive Your Payment

Once the tow truck driver has successfully loaded your vehicle and had you sign the necessary paperwork to complete the sale, you will be provided with a cash payment for your vehicle. While having this bit of extra cash in hand is sure to be exciting, the fact that you have successfully completed this process and cleared up some extra space on your property is sure to be icing on the cake as well.
